Internal Communications Manager

2 days ago


United Kingdom Insight Select Full time €50,000

Internal Communications Lead / London / Hybrid / Up to £50,000

An excellent opportunity has arisen with a global brand for an internal communications and engagement manager. As Internal Communications Lead, you'll foster effective communication and engagement across the organisation. Partnering with the CEO, HR, directors, and managers, you will drive culture change rooted within a new performance framework. You'll implement and evolve creative communication strategies to keep colleagues informed, inspired, and aligned with their core values.

Role and Responsibilities:

  • Communications planning development: implement an internal communications plan and framework
  • CEO business partnering: act as the CEO’s internal communications business partner, supporting with leadership visibility, key messaging, stakeholder events and presentations
  • Directorate business partnering: partner with the executive leadership team to develop internal communications that support strategy, enhance employee engagement, and reflect our values
  • HR engagement lead: Work with our HR team to develop and deliver the employee engagement strategy and support the organisation with engagement initiatives.
  • Channel management: manage current internal communications channels and ensure they are fit for purpose and evolve in line with metrics and feedback
  • Event management: lead on organisational away-days, social events, and town halls. Including event development, facilitation, management, and communications
  • Content creation: a natural storyteller able to manage, edit and create engaging and compelling content for internal communications channels, including intranet articles, email announcements, organisational events, and presentations.
  • Message development: develop key messages and talking points to ensure consistency across directorates, teams and levels of the organisation
  • Metrics and analytics: monitor and analyse the effectiveness of internal communications initiatives, using metrics and feedback to inform and drive decision making, and continually improve strategies and tactics.

Essential Skills and Experience:

3+ years’ experience within a communications role, a smaller tech organisation preferred

Experience engaging with senior leadership teams

Experience with Sharepoint building

Experience developing, designing and writing communications via various channels such as articles and blog posts

Proficient in multiple communication tools and platforms

Good understanding of storytelling and presenting data

Company Benefits:

  • Hybrid working – 3 days per week in the London office
  • 25 days annual leave + bank holidays
  • Increasing annual leave entitlement after service
  • Private Healthcare
  • Free gym membership
  • Inflated pension contribution
  • Even more great healthcare benefits

Internal Communications Lead / London / Hybrid / Up to £50,000



  • United Kingdom Sanderson Full time €40,000 - €55,000

    Facilities & Internal Communications Manager Glasgow (3-4 days on-site) £40k - £55k Are you a skilled Facilities Manager with an interest in advancing your career in internal communication? Or do you have a blend of facilities expertise and internal communications experience, ready to step up into a hybrid role? Our client is looking for a Facilities &...


  • United Kingdom Sanderson Full time €40,000 - €55,000

    Facilities & Internal Communications Manager Glasgow (3-4 days on-site)£40k - £55k Are you a skilled Facilities Manager with an interest in advancing your career in internal communication? Or do you have a blend of facilities expertise and internal communications experience, ready to step up into a hybrid role? If so, this is the opportunity for you!...

  • Communications intern

    2 weeks ago


    United Kingdom DiverseJobsMatter Full time

    The Europe Communications team are looking for two enthusiastic individuals with creative, fresh ideas to work for a world-leading technology company. The successful candidates will take on international roles and responsibilities to ensure the functioning of global communication campaigns and events. We are a $50+ billion Fortune 100 company, present...

  • Communications intern

    2 weeks ago


    United Kingdom DiverseJobsMatter Full time

    The Europe Communications team are looking for two enthusiastic individuals with creative, fresh ideas to work for a world-leading technology company. The successful candidates will take on international roles and responsibilities to ensure the functioning of global communication campaigns and events. We are a $50+ billion Fortune 100 company, present...


  • United Kingdom Insight Select Full time €50,000

    Internal Communications Lead / London / Hybrid / Up to £50,000 An excellent opportunity has arisen with a global brand for an internal communications and engagement manager. As Internal Communications Lead, you'll foster effective communication and engagement across the organisation. Partnering with the CEO, HR, directors, and managers, you will drive...


  • United Kingdom Addition+ Full time

    We are currently recruiting for a multinational recognised hospitality company, for the role of Internal Communications / Sharepoint Lead. It’s an exciting opportunity to work for one of the nation’s leading hospitality organisations that currently employee 30,000 people in hotels and restaurants across the UK, with strong corporate responsibility,...


  • United Kingdom Manpower Internal Talent Full time

    Manpower - National Sales Manager Location: Blended (attend each office location once every 5-6 weeks) plus travel for new business opportunities. Successful candidate must have a driving license and access to their own vehicle. An incredible opportunity to join an experienced team of Sales Managers and contribute to the growth of Manpower business....


  • United Kingdom Guinness Partnership Full time

    JOB DESCRIPTION About the role We're looking for an Internal Communications Officer to join our dynamic Communications team on a fixed-term contract up to 9-months. This role can be based in our Oldham, Bristol, or London offices, offering hybrid working opportunities. The successful candidate will help make sure that internal communication channels...


  • united kingdom Guinness Partnership Full time

    JOB DESCRIPTIONAbout the role We're looking for an Internal Communications Officer to join our dynamic Communications team on a fixed-term contract up to 9-months. This role can be based in our Oldham, Bristol, or London offices, offering hybrid working opportunities. The successful candidate will help make sure that internal communication channels are used...


  • United Kingdom Manpower Internal Talent Full time

    Manpower - National Sales Manager Location: Covering the North of England, Scotland and Northern Ireland. Branch locations are.. Belfast, Grange mouth, Grimsby, Wigan, Newcastle, and Leeds. Working Pattern: Blended (attend each office location once every 5-6 weeks) plus travel for new business opportunities. Successful candidate must have a driving...


  • United Kingdom Addition+ Full time

    We are currently recruiting for a multinational recognised hospitality company, for the role of Internal Communications / Sharepoint Lead. It’s an exciting opportunity to work for one of the nation’s leading hospitality organisations that currently employee 30,000 people in hotels and restaurants across the UK, with strong corporate responsibility,...


  • United Kingdom Oeson Learning™ Full time

    About Oeson: Oeson is a leading global IT corporation recognized for its expertise in delivering exceptional IT and Ed-tech services. Our specialties include digital marketing, data science, data analytics, business analytics, cybersecurity, data engineering, UI/UX design, web development, and app development. We are committed to innovation, excellence, and...


  • united kingdom Royal British Legion Trading Ltd Full time

    About The RoleDo you want to become part of an innovative team at the forefront of delivering the transformation agenda for a leading UK Charity?Were looking for an exceptional internal communications professional to play a critical role in leading the development and delivery of the change communications for RBLs transformation agenda in this newly created...


  • United Kingdom Royal British Legion Trading Ltd Full time

    About The Role Do you want to become part of an innovative team at the forefront of delivering the transformation agenda for a leading UK Charity? Were looking for an exceptional internal communications professional to play a critical role in leading the development and delivery of the change communications for RBLs transformation agenda in this newly...


  • United Kingdom GTT Communications, Inc. Full time

    Business Development Director Position Title: Business Development Director (New Logo Acquisition) Location: UK, remote GTT provides secure global connectivity, improving network performance and agility for your people, places, applications, and clouds. We operate a global Tier 1 internet network and provide a comprehensive suite of cloud...


  • United Kingdom Oeson Learning™ Full time

    About Oeson: Oeson is a leading global IT corporation recognized for its expertise in delivering exceptional IT and Ed-tech services. Our specialties include digital marketing, data science, data analytics, business analytics, cybersecurity, data engineering, UI/UX design, web development, and app development. We are committed to innovation, excellence,...


  • United Kingdom IPOE Consulting Full time

    Global Investment & Trading company based in the City of London, are looking to recruit an Internal Audit Manager. Main responsibilities will include; To manage the fulfilment of the annual audit plan through the audit of specified companies/business organisations within the group. To ensure the audits are properly conducted, and the results of the...


  • United Kingdom IPOE Consulting Full time

    Global Investment & Trading company based in the City of London, are looking to recruit an Internal Audit Manager. To manage the fulfilment of the annual audit plan through the audit of specified companies/business organisations within the group. To ensure the audits are properly conducted, and the results of the audits are fairly reported to both the...


  • United Kingdom GTT Communications, Inc. Full time

    Business Development Director Position Title: Business Development Director (New Logo Acquisition) Location: UK, remote Grade: Individual Contributor About GTT: GTT provides secure global connectivity, improving network performance and agility for your people, places, applications, and clouds. We operate a global Tier 1 internet network and...

  • Intern

    2 days ago


    United Kingdom Principal Asset Management Full time

    About the job What You'll Do Principal Asset Management is seeking 5 interns to join their London office during the summer period. Our 10-week summer internship provides those interested in working in Investments, providing a rich opportunity to experience what it is like to work in Asset Management. You will join a cohort with 4 other interns, where...